  • A Brief History Of Sunbeam
    By: Levi Quinn | - Sunbeam was registered in 1888 by John Marston Co. Ltd, based in Wolverhampton, England, as a marque. John Marston Co. Ltd was originally involved in the manufacture of bicycles and motorcycles and ventured into cars later on. The marque was used for the bicycles, the motorcycles and the cars. The founder of the brand, John Marston, had been trained in the Jeddo Works in Wolverhampton where he was a metal lacquerer.   • The History Of Peugeot
    By: Paul Robin | - Peugeot began its reign in motorsports since the very beginning with the entering five cars for the Paris-Rouen Trials in 1894. These motorsport trials are largely recognized as the first motor sports competition. It was not until 1912 that Peugeot made its most notable contribution to the world of motor sports when one of the entered cars won the French Grand Prix.
